If you leave earnings to accumulate in a C Corp thinking you're getting around the double taxation, you'll eventually learn about the accumulated earnings tax...C Corp make sense under very limited fact patterns...e.g. foreign owners, owners that want heavy fringe benefits, silicon valley types that envision a 1202 stock sale exit strategy, etc.
